    How to Remove Oil Stains From a Driveway: 8 Effective Methods

    JustinBy JustinMarch 18, 20245 Mins Read

    ​​​​​​It is common for driveways to accumulate oil stains. The reasons include leaks in vehicles, maintenance spills or weather conditions. Besides, vehicle fluids and other substances can cause driveway stains.

    Whether it’s from a small spill or years of accumulated grime, tackling oil stains requires a combination of patience, effort, and the right tools. How to remove oil stains from the driveway?

    Don’t worry expert driveway cleaners have shared some effective techniques to do the work. Have a look

    How to Remove Oil Stains From a Driveway: 8 Effective Methods

    Method 1:  Using baking soda 

    Baking soda can eliminate fresh oil spots because it is naturally an absorbent. Use a lot of baking soda to cover the oil spot. Wait a few hours or even overnight for the baking soda to soak up the oil.

    It may take a few hours or even overnight for the baking soda to absorb the oil. After that, scrub the baking soda into the spot with a stiff brush. After the baking soda has been swept away, wash the area with water to remove all the oil.

    Method 2: Dish soap to remove grease

    Dish soap is a strong degreaser that can get rid of oil spots. Mix warm water and dish soap. One dish of soap and ten parts water is a good place to start. Then, put a lot of the soapy fluid on the stain. Scrub the spot and the oil off with a stiff brush.

    You have to use clean water to rinse the area well. If the spot doesn’t come out, do it again, but use a stronger soap solution this time.

    Method 3: Try Vinegar

    Vinegar is acidic, it can help get rid of oil marks. It may not work well on all types of driveway surfaces. How to do it:

    • Put the vinegar solution on a small, hidden part of your road to ensure it doesn’t change the colour.
    • Soak the spot in white vinegar if it’s safe. You can leave it alone for 15 to 30 minutes. Use a stiff brush to scrub the spot, and then run water over it several times.

    Method 4: The Kitty Litter Absorbent

    Kitty litter is easy to find and works well to soak up new oil spills. You have to do these things:

    • Put a thick layer of kitty litter over the oil spot. The litter will soak up the oil because it is absorbent.
    • Let the kitty litter sit on the spot for a few hours to soak up the oil fully.
    • Clean up the used cat litter by sweeping it away. If you need to, do it again with new litter until the oil is gone.

    Method 5: The commercial degreaser punch

    Degreasers sold in stores are made to get rid of tough oil spots. But they can be rough, so be careful when you use them.

Put the degreaser straight on the stain and wait until the manufacturer says so. To remove any leftover soap, rinse the area well with clean water.

    Method 6: Use a hot water pressure washer

    First, ensure the pressure washer is on a low setting so it doesn’t damage the concrete. Wear the right safety gear, like gloves, goggles, and closed-toe shoes.

    Note: When you use the power washer, use hot water. The oil is easy to get rid of when you use hot water. Spray the stain from a safe distance and rinse the area well with clean as you work in small parts.

    Method 7: Use laundry detergent

    Some oil spots can be cleaned up surprisingly well with laundry detergent, especially ones made for greasy stains. To try it, do this:

    • Mix warm water and washing detergent. One part soap to ten parts water is a good place to start.
    • Put a lot of the soapy fluid on the stain. Scrub the spot and the oil off with a stiff brush.

    Use clean water to rinse the area well. If the spot doesn’t come out, do it again, but this time, use a stronger detergent solution.

    Note: This method might only work for some kinds of concrete, and it might leave a film behind.

    Method 8: Calling a Professional

    It’s best to call a professional driveway cleaning service for tough oil spots or big spills. They know how to eliminate even the toughest oil spots and have the right tools and cleaning products.

    Wrap up 

    Test any cleaner on a small, hidden part of your road before using it on the stain. It might take more than one treatment and some hard work to remove oil spots. With these helpful tips, you can get rid of those unsightly oil spots and make your driveway look new again.
